Aaron C. Ellis

Aaron Ellis was born and raised in Walker, Louisiana. After graduating from Walker High School in 1989, Aaron joined the United States Navy, where he served aboard the USS Ranger in the Persian Gulf War. Upon his return from the service, he attended Louisiana State University on the G.I. Bill, where he received his Bachelor’s degree.

Aaron then attended law school and received his Juris Doctorate from Louisiana State University’s Paul M. Hebert Law Center. He began practicing law in Livingston Parish, where he remains today, with his office just one block away from the historic Old Walker High School. Over the years, Aaron has represented hundreds of individuals and businesses handling a wide variety of legal cases, including business and commercial litigation and transactions, successions, civil and criminal defense, domestic matters, personal injury, and property litigation.

Aaron resides in Walker with his wife Jovita. They have two adult children and one grandchild. In his spare time, He enjoys spending time with his family and friends, hunting, fishing, and rooting for the LSU Tigers. A long time supporter of Walker schools, Aaron has been the Voice of the Wildcats for an entire generation athletes and football fans.
